Trial and billing

How the 14-day trial works, what happens at the end, and how to upgrade.

What the trial includes

New signups get 14 days at Growth-level — every feature turned on, and the same limits Growth partners have: up to 50 active clients, 10 team members, 50 GB of document storage. No credit card required upfront.

What happens at trial end

  • You'll get email warnings 3 days out, 1 day out, and on the day it ends.
  • 3-day grace period after the trial ends. The workspace stays fully functional; a warning banner explains what's about to change.
  • After the grace window, the workspace goes read-only for major new creations. You (and your clients) can still see everything — no data is ever deleted, hidden, or paused. New clients, team invites, document uploads, and custom templates all pause until you pick a plan. Ongoing work — updating existing clients, messaging, marking steps done — continues normally.
  • Automation emails (weekly digest, quiet-client nudges, overdue reminders) also pause for expired trials so nobody gets a stale reminder about a stalled workspace.

Upgrading

Head to Settings → Upgrade to pick a plan. Billing is handled by Stripe — enter card, subscribe, your plan and limits update within seconds via webhook. Manage invoices, payment method, and cancellation from the same page via Manage Billing (opens the Stripe-hosted billing portal).

Plans

  • Founding — $49/mo, locked for life. Growth-level features and limits. First 25 MSPs only. See Founding membership.
  • Solo — $79/mo. 5 clients, 2 team members, 1 GB storage. Built-in templates only.
  • Starter — $149/mo. 10 clients, 3 team members, 10 GB storage. Adds automations.
  • Growth — $349/mo. 50 clients, 10 team members, 50 GB storage. Adds custom templates, portal analytics, hide-branding toggle.
Running more than 50 clients, or need a BAA / DPA? Email support@onboardl.io.

Extending your trial

Trial extensions are handled case-by-case — email support@onboardl.io and we'll bump the deadline. Grace + expired-state behavior is the same as above.
